Perpendicular slopes are opposite reciprocals.
This means the slope of the line perpendicular to GA will be the opposite reciprocal of -5.
Reciprocal of -5: -1/5
Opposite of -1/5: 1/5
The slope of the line perpendicular to GA is 1/5.

Answer:
5^ -7 =1 / 5^7
Step-by-step explanation:
(5^2)-^2/ 5^3
We know that a^b^c = a^(b*c)
(5^2)-^2 = 5^(2*-2) = 5^-4
5^-4/ 5^3
We know that a^b /a^c = a^ (b-c)
5 ^ (-4-3)
5^ -7
If we don't want to use negative exponents
We know that a^ -b = 1/ a^b
1 / 5^7
